Charity Choice is a thrift store located on 29th Drive and Marsha Sharp Freeway (across from United in the old United space).
So here's how it works. Let's say you were to have a garage sale and wanted to get rid of everything you didn't sale. Simply take it over to Charity Choice and tell them that you want to donate the items on behalf of NAMI Lubbock (our charity number is #4). Once NAMI gets enough items in stock, then we are able to receive "commissions" if you will off the sales of the items donated in our name. Kind of works like a consignment store accept the non-profit gets the sale.
Now here's the catch. NAMI will receive a check at the end of each month ONLY WHEN we have sold over $50 worth of merchandise. This is very easily attainable however if you donate large items such as furniture, desks, etc.
The other nice thing about Charity Choice is NAMI Lubbock will eventually be sent vouchers that we can disperse to those who may come to us looking for clothing, necessities, etc. For those of ya'll that aren't aware, about 1/3 of the consumers that visit the CLC on a daily basis are homeless. This would be a great way to help those in need and provide outreach to that population.
